Not only do tourists flock to the city for the July fiesta, but pilgrims make their way through the town on their journey along the Camino de Santiago (or Way of St. James) to Santiago de Compostela. However, there’s so much more to see and do in Pamplona and, after living there for a year, here’s our top 5 from an authentic perspective!
